public interface JobSchedulesClient
Modifier and Type | Method and Description |
---|---|
JobScheduleInner |
create(String resourceGroupName,
String automationAccountName,
UUID jobScheduleId,
JobScheduleCreateParameters parameters)
Create a job schedule.
|
com.azure.core.http.rest.Response<JobScheduleInner> |
createWithResponse(String resourceGroupName,
String automationAccountName,
UUID jobScheduleId,
JobScheduleCreateParameters parameters,
com.azure.core.util.Context context)
Create a job schedule.
|
void |
delete(String resourceGroupName,
String automationAccountName,
UUID jobScheduleId)
Delete the job schedule identified by job schedule name.
|
com.azure.core.http.rest.Response<Void> |
deleteWithResponse(String resourceGroupName,
String automationAccountName,
UUID jobScheduleId,
com.azure.core.util.Context context)
Delete the job schedule identified by job schedule name.
|
JobScheduleInner |
get(String resourceGroupName,
String automationAccountName,
UUID jobScheduleId)
Retrieve the job schedule identified by job schedule name.
|
com.azure.core.http.rest.Response<JobScheduleInner> |
getWithResponse(String resourceGroupName,
String automationAccountName,
UUID jobScheduleId,
com.azure.core.util.Context context)
Retrieve the job schedule identified by job schedule name.
|
com.azure.core.http.rest.PagedIterable<JobScheduleInner> |
listByAutomationAccount(String resourceGroupName,
String automationAccountName)
Retrieve a list of job schedules.
|
com.azure.core.http.rest.PagedIterable<JobScheduleInner> |
listByAutomationAccount(String resourceGroupName,
String automationAccountName,
String filter,
com.azure.core.util.Context context)
Retrieve a list of job schedules.
|
void delete(String resourceGroupName, String automationAccountName, UUID jobScheduleId)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.jobScheduleId
- The job schedule name.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.com.azure.core.http.rest.Response<Void> deleteWithResponse(String resourceGroupName, String automationAccountName, UUID jobScheduleId, com.azure.core.util.Context context)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.jobScheduleId
- The job schedule name.context
- The context to associate with this operation.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.JobScheduleInner get(String resourceGroupName, String automationAccountName, UUID jobScheduleId)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.jobScheduleId
- The job schedule name.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.com.azure.core.http.rest.Response<JobScheduleInner> getWithResponse(String resourceGroupName, String automationAccountName, UUID jobScheduleId, com.azure.core.util.Context context)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.jobScheduleId
- The job schedule name.context
- The context to associate with this operation.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.JobScheduleInner create(String resourceGroupName, String automationAccountName, UUID jobScheduleId, JobScheduleCreateParameters parameters)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.jobScheduleId
- The job schedule name.parameters
- The parameters supplied to the create job schedule operation.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.com.azure.core.http.rest.Response<JobScheduleInner> createWithResponse(String resourceGroupName, String automationAccountName, UUID jobScheduleId, JobScheduleCreateParameters parameters, com.azure.core.util.Context context)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.jobScheduleId
- The job schedule name.parameters
- The parameters supplied to the create job schedule operation.context
- The context to associate with this operation.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.com.azure.core.http.rest.PagedIterable<JobScheduleInner> listByAutomationAccount(String resourceGroupName, String automationAccountName)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.com.azure.core.http.rest.PagedIterable<JobScheduleInner> listByAutomationAccount(String resourceGroupName, String automationAccountName, String filter, com.azure.core.util.Context context)
resourceGroupName
- Name of an Azure Resource group.automationAccountName
- The name of the automation account.filter
- The filter to apply on the operation.context
- The context to associate with this operation.IllegalArgumentException
- thrown if parameters fail the validation.com.azure.core.management.exception.ManagementException
- thrown if the request is rejected by server.RuntimeException
- all other wrapped checked exceptions if the request fails to be sent.Copyright © 2021 Microsoft Corporation. All rights reserved.